WAIKOHU GOLF

MEDAL MATCH WINNERS (Herald Correspondent.) A monthly medal match was played on the Waikohu golf links last weekend in ideal conditions, the best cards returned in the women’s section being:— Miss J. Russell, 104-38-66; Mrs. H. O’Connell, 91-21-70; Mrs. R. F. Hutchinson, 86-10-76; Mrs. G. Gregory, 99-23-76; Miss G. Parkinson, 109-38-71; Mrs. A. Moverley, 111-32-79; Mrs. E. Cranswick, 123-38-85; Miss Josephine Scott, 119—31—88. The winner of the men’s section was R. F. Hutchinson, with a net score of 67. In the Stableford bogey match played recently the best score was handed in by Mrs. A. Moverley. A Stableford bogey has been arranged for the coming week-end in conjunction with the first round of the eclectic competition.
